IEM Sydney opening matches recap
Seven favorites have won their opening games to begin their IEM Sydney campaign while BIG shocked MOUZ in 30 rounds.
Two double-elimination groups, each featuring eight teams, kicked off the action at IEM Sydney. In Group A, Liquid got past BOOT-d[S] without much trouble as the North Americans put on a strong performance on the T-side on Nuke, winning it with a 16-9 scoreline.
In a tight affair, BIG got the better of MOUZ without Ismailcan "XANTARES" Dörtkardeş, taking the victory in 30 rounds on Inferno. Johannes "tabseN" Wodarz topped the scoreboard with 33 kills and a 1.72 rating while Özgür "woxic" Eker could only get five kills.

Renegades and Ninjas in Pyjamas secured 16-13 victories against MVP PK and eUnited, respectively, to advance to the upper-bracket semi-finals where they will meet each other in a best-of-three.
In Group B, FaZe managed to defeat Chiefs with ease despite fielding two stand-ins, winning 16-5 on Dust2. NRG were equally as comfortable, beating ViCi 16-4 on Mirage to become FaZe's opponents in the next round.
The other two games in the group featured fnatic and MIBR who respectively got past HEROIC and Grayhound to remain in the upper-bracket.
